The reality is the Louisiana Republican Party as an organization, meaning the Republican State Central Committee, has zero influence when it comes to actual governing and much less influence than they think they should have when it comes to influence in political races. David Vitter’s team and Bobby Jindal’s team sparred to fill the SCC and its leadership with their people…and look where both of those guys and their inner circle are at now in Louisiana power.
There are some elected officials and/or their spouses who serve on the SCC in order to help fill vacant seats that no one wanted to run for, but the most enthusiastic/activist SCC members are on that because that’s the only position they could ever run for and get elected. That any maybe their neighborhood HOA. They fancy themselves “politicians”, but have no clue about having to do the work of a lawmaker/council member, and some just allow themselves to be useful pawns for other politicians.
